Each manufacturing course of requires a unique minimal thickness for the half to print successfully and with no knife edge. If the design file does not meet these minimal thicknesses, the tip outcome could be warping or a rippled edge.

The dangers related to skinny walls and fragile options are frequent in additive manufacturing. Known as “knife edges,” these are very skinny areas in 3D design files which might be below printer tolerances for integrity and stability in the piece. These areas could cause issues, such as deformities, making part of the piece fragile, or destroy the integrity of the part altogether if the knife edge is not rectified.
